About The Position

This is an ongoing coverage need for an Emergency Medicine Nurse Practitioner (NP) or Physician Assistant (PA) at a Level III trauma center. The average daily patient volume is 36. An onsite orientation is required one day prior to the first scheduled shift. The position is for an independent contractor (1099) and does not include typical W-2 employment benefits. Credentialing takes approximately 30 days.
